The Site Administrator provides oversight of the facility, coordinates activities and services offered at the site, and provides administrative support to program leadership. Overall, the Site Administrator contributes to the CHS high performance culture by exhibiting our values and providing quality results that position CHS as the leader in delivering proactive behavioral health, case management, community and early childhood solutions for children and families.

Primary Job Functions
1. Oversee BRIDGES facility and provide administrative and coordination assistance to the program.
- Oversee facilities such as coordination of space planning and building/equipment maintenance.
- Collect and maintain supporting data/information for all designated service delivery activities.
- Coordinate data collection (such as surveys, attendance at events, pre/post test scores) among program teams, service partners and programs.
- Support the scheduling of events and activities such as parent/family activity night or workshops.
- Maintain the Community Calendar for events and activities.
- Provide administrative support, which may include clerical duties, database entry and maintenance.
- Provide meeting support, take and transcribe notes to produce meeting minutes, prepare and distribute handouts, etc.
- Provide coverage as receptionist and perform tasks such as answering telephones, opening and distributing mail, etc.
- Order and maintain adequate office supplies.
